VFA-41 was tasked with escorting a flight of B-52s on a strike mission.
VFA-41 launched three flights, two flights of F/A-18 Hornets, and a flight of two F-14 Tomcats. VFA-41 aircraft met up with the strike package at the designated time and location and began providing escort. A flight of SU-27s was detected ingressing the area and VFA-41 Tomcats (Dealer 3) intercepted and eliminated the bandits. A 2nd flight of F-5 was later detected heading toward the bomber flight. The Tomcats eliminated one of the four F-5s and then disengaged due to lack of long range ordnance. The remaining F-5s were lost track of at that point. They ended up reappearing merged with the bombers and Dealer 1. Dealer 1 managed to take down two of the F-5s but lost all three of it's own aircraft in the engagement. Dealer 2, While returning from getting fuel intercepted and took out the remain F-5.
Two of the four bombers delivered their bombs on target. All four returned to base and landed.
Mission successful, but with heavy losses.
